When you write a check and theres not enough funds in your account when its presented, this is considered non-sufficient funds (NSF). When a check is returned due to NSF, its returned to the payee that deposited the check, at their bank.
What Happens If You Write a Check With No Money in Your Account? If you write a check and have no money in your account, it will be returned for insufficient funds. Writing a check without money in your account, willfully or by accident, the person you wrote it out to wont get paid.
Contact the customer Explain the situation to them. Ask the customer to pay with cash or credit card. If you cant docHub the customer by phone, you can try sending a bounced check letter to customer. Tell the customer why you are contacting them.
When payment cannot be completed it is often considered as bounced. If a bank receives a check written on an account with insufficient funds, the bank can refuse payment and charge the account holder an NSF fee. Additionally, a penalty or fee may be charged by the merchant for the returned check.
When you cash or deposit a check and theres not enough funds to cover it in the account its drawn on, this is also considered non-sufficient funds (NSF). When a check is returned for NSF in this manner, the check is generally returned back to you. This allows you to redeposit the check at a later time, if available.
Generally, a returned check is one that a bank declines to honor typically because theres not enough money in the check writers account to cover the amount of the payment. You might know this situation as a bounced check, while the bank calls it nonsufficient funds, or NSF.
